Output 0312557e4e423b75e54febaae11dea01f011a2938fbc0164814e5afb4d0a1efc:15

value
527670
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 652a8357f4e5316d104a8b31df89c5984dd34a59 OP_EQUALVERIFY OP_CHECKSIG
address
1ADvBEabjG7FSSDU6PvbRpNNgX4Keouqej
transaction
0312557e4e423b75e54febaae11dea01f011a2938fbc0164814e5afb4d0a1efc
spent
true